Blood lead concentration that should initiate clinical intervention
In all cases of suspected or confirmed lead exposure the patient or carer should be given information about potential sources of lead exposure, methods for reducing continuing exposure and the importance of good nutrition, in particular adequate dietary intake of iron and calcium. (GPS)

Gastrointestinal decontamination after ingestion of a lead foreign body or other lead-containing material
Take measures to remove solid lead objects, such as a bullets, lead pellets, jewellery, fishing or curtain weights, that are known to be in the stomach. (S)
